MILLIONS of Americans have been issued a travel warning if they are heading off on vacation and are taking weight loss jabs.
Not only that, but they are also reminded to take action in the TSA line to get exemption from a key travel rule.
It is estimated that at least 6 per cent of the US population is currently taking the increasingly popular jabs, according to a recent KFF health tracking poll .
This translates to just over 20 million Americans.
Whether the medication is being used for health or aesthetic reasons, anyone traveling with their jabs must take action before they fly.
Experts have warned that the millions using the injections risk invalidating their travel insurance if they take off without checking and possibly amending their policy.
